Output d87fc3f0457e5989bb2c537de2cda0e9cdc0936f7028d34b718448d2a02b0c83:45

value
1473429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ddb26882e06a63265c44314eb77e6752ad007cc7 OP_EQUAL
address
3MuEyxfhX6TVKcQ6sfcZNtxpxpAegNPbx4
transaction
d87fc3f0457e5989bb2c537de2cda0e9cdc0936f7028d34b718448d2a02b0c83
spent
true